| | the band gets back to their roots in avant-garde classical music. 100+ minutes of modern compositions on double lp or double cd.
music composed by john cage, yoko ono, cornelius cardew, steve reich, takehisa kosugi, nicolas slonimsky, george maciunas, james tenney, pauline oliveros and christian wolff.
sonic youth the syr series
having completed construction on their manhattan studios in 1996, sonic youth suddenly found themselves in a position to create unadulterated by the tyranny of time and space. as a result of their natural writing process, whereby collective improvisation congeals over time into song structures, they began to amass a small mountain of tape, most of it containing raw, wild, spontaneous music they reckoned wouldn't be "commercial" enough for geffen to release.
yet the material seemed just as essential and true to their mission, and showed an important side of the band and their process that was usually inacessible to their fans. so instead of a problem, sy saw an opportunity — they decided to release these secret sonic glimpses themselves. sonic youth recordings was born. |
